Vacancy Description
  • Within our UK-based Electrical Team we undertake projects across all process industries. We provide concept design to delivery solutions for projects ranging from HV infrastructure through to Process Automation Control Systems. We are looking to grow our team and create a sustainable future. We are looking for an apprentice to join our team to develop into a consultant engineer supporting our clients on projects across the UK and our overseas colleagues across the world. We are building a team to lead the business globally. Our projects can vary from feasibility studies on HV capacity to Control System Migrations in a Brewery in South East Asia. Over the course of the apprenticeship, the training will not be limited to your Level 6 degree with Derby College. We will develop with you a career plan and set development goals across your apprenticeship that will range from specific technical requirements, project management and leadership assessments.
Project Work:
  • Electrical concept Design on a project by project basis
  • Writing specifications for Panel, Instrumentation & Installations
  • Writing specifications for Building Services
  • Writing of project documentation
  • Management of the electrical element of any assigned project inclusive of suppliers and contractors
  • Onsite I/O Testing & Commissioning Support
  • Ensuring As Built Documentation is completed by suppliers and issued to clients
Sales:
  • Supporting the Solutions Sales Team with proposal & costings for the EC&I elements of quotations
  • Attending Sales visits with prospective customers
  • Advising the customer on possible technical/technological developments, service opportunities and optimisation possibilities
Documentation:
  • Preparing Documentation as detailed but not limited to
  • Feasibility Studies
  • URS (EC&I)
  • Engineering Schedules
  • Witness Test Reports
  • Commissioning Schedules
  • Collate As Built Documentation
  • Review other suppliers' documentation in a timely manner
  • Produce Project documentation using the Niras or Customer Standards

Employer Description: NIRAS – Building a sustainable future together. NIRAS is an international, foundation and employee-owned consultancy founded in Denmark in 1956. With over 3,000 specialists in 35 countries, we’re at the forefront of sustainable, forward-thinking solutions across industries from Food & Beverage, Renewable Energy, Ports & Marine, and International Development to advance manufacturing, water and utilities, green fuels and beyond. Here in the UK, our team of engineers, environmentalists, and project managers are dedicated to making a difference. Our commitment to sustainable progress drives every project, and we thrive on partnerships that seek to shape a better, greener future for our clients and communities worldwide.
